  1. there are three major divisions on the periodic table: the “s block”, the “d block” and the “p block”. where are these blocks of elements located? give the column numbers of their locations. (yes, there is also an “f block” but we won’t consider that now.) s block: columns ______ d block: columns ____ p block: columns ______

Explanation:

Brief Explanations

The s - block elements are in columns 1 and 2. The d - block elements are in columns 3 - 12. The p - block elements are in columns 13 - 18. This is based on the electron - filling order and the Aufbau principle. In the s - block, the outermost electrons are in s orbitals. For the d - block, the outermost electrons are in d orbitals (after some s - orbital filling in some cases). In the p - block, the outermost electrons are in p orbitals.

Answer:

s block: columns 1 - 2
d block: columns 3 - 12
p block: columns 13 - 18
